According to Lisbon Coach Brian Hall, this year's Lisbon team has set the program's record for season dual wins. The Lions are 19-2. The previous best was a 17-1 record.Is this year's teams the teams of old that fielded wrestlers with the name Morningstar, Stoneking, Alger, Butteris, Happel, Light, Stewart, etc., etc. No. Were they aided by hosting a second dual event where they went 5-0. Yes.Don't let the last two points diminish how good this team is and how they have rekindled that great success associated with Lisbon wrestling over the years.Freshman 103-pounder Kolbi Kohl has been impressive, 119-pounder Chris Taylor has been exceptional, Tait and Zach Simpson at 112 and 140, respectively, have had good seasons. Mitch Montgomery is strong at 215. They make a strong nucleus to build around. On a side note, I was informed we published results listing Tait Simpson as Tait Stamp.
